Two Women Go Dumpster Diving
SHERIFF'S BLOTTER: Also, a juvenile prowler, a stolen car and more.
At 10:57 a.m.Tuesday, deputies received several calls of two women digging through trash cans near the Via Cordova-Calle Raquel intersection and the Via Solana-Via Rubi intersection. Both calls said the women were seen in a silver vehicle.
At 8:25 p.m. Monday, a juvenile prowler was reported in the 25600 block of Dana Mesa Drive. According to the report, the residents decided not to press charges but release the suspect into the custody of the suspected prowler’s parents.
At 4:57 p.m. Monday, a caller reported not a stolen bike but a found bike near the Paseo Duran-Calle Arroyo intersection. According to the informant, the bike had been laying on the bike trail for some time.

At 4:46 p.m. Sunday, a caller reported illegal peddling near the intersection of Alipaz and Del Obispo streets. According to the report, someone was in front of a Laundromat selling DVDs.
At 9:50 a.m. Sunday, a car was reported stolen in the 30000 block of Hillside Terrace. According to the report, a white Mercedes SL 500 had gone missing.

At 5:11 p.m. Saturday, a non-injury accident at the corner of Stonehill Drive and Camino Capistrano resulted in the arrest of a 62-year-old woman, who was cited and released. There were no further details.
These are selected reports from the San Juan Capistrano Police Dispatch Services log throughout the past few days. The calls represent what was told to a sheriff's deputy in the field by the radio dispatcher. No presumption of criminal guilt or affiliation should be drawn from the information provided.
